A Day in Igatpuri: Exploring the Natural Beauty

8:00 AM: Start your journey

Begin your day in Igatpuri, a beautiful hill station known for its lush green landscapes and serene atmosphere. Start your journey from your location and head towards Igatpuri.

10:00 AM: Bhatsa River Valley

Arrive at Bhatsa River Valley, a picturesque spot surrounded by hills and the Bhatsa River. Enjoy the breathtaking views of the valley and take a leisurely walk along the river banks. Cost: Free. Time spent: 1 hour.

11:30 AM: Tringalwadi Fort

Embark on a trek to Tringalwadi Fort, a historic fortress atop a hill. Explore the ancient architecture and take in panoramic views of the surrounding mountains and villages. Cost: Free. Time spent: 2 hours.

1:30 PM: Ghatandevi Temple

Visit Ghatandevi Temple, a sacred site dedicated to the goddess Ghatandevi. Experience the spiritual ambiance and admire the beautiful architecture of the temple. Cost: Free. Time spent: 1 hour.

2:30 PM: Kalsubai Peak

Embark on a thrilling trek to Kalsubai Peak, the highest peak in Maharashtra. Enjoy the scenic beauty and conquer the summit for breathtaking panoramic views. Cost: Free. Time spent: 4-5 hours (round trip).

7:00 PM: Dhamma Giri Meditation Centre

End your day with a visit to Dhamma Giri Meditation Centre, a renowned Vipassana meditation center. Relax your mind and learn about the teachings of Gautam Buddha amidst a tranquil environment. Cost: Free. Time spent: 1-2 hours.

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For those seeking off the beaten path attractions, consider exploring the Igatpuri Waterfalls. These natural waterfalls offer a refreshing experience and are perfect for nature lovers. Another local favorite is the Vipassana International Academy, where you can learn and practice meditation techniques in a serene setting.
